BETTER SLEEP. SAFER WORKPLACES. HEALTHIER TEAMS.

When sleep apnea is properly diagnosed and managed, the benefits for employees—and their performance—are substantial. Here’s what the data shows:


  • Improved Focus and Cognitive Performance Employees treated for sleep apnea show a 38% improvement in attention, memory, and executive function within just 3 months. 


  • Higher Energy and Engagement. Treated individuals report significantly reduced daytime fatigue and increased workplace engagement—leading to more consistent and energized performance throughout the day.


  • Better Mood, Fewer Distractions. CPAP therapy reduces symptoms of depression and anxiety by up to 50%, improving emotional regulation and reducing mental distractions at work.


  •  Reduced Absenteeism and Sick Days. Employees with untreated sleep apnea are 2x more likely to take disability leave and miss more days due to illness. Treatment decreases these risks significantly. 


  • Enhanced Workplace Relationships. Better mood, less irritability, and more energy improve team communication and collaboration—leading to stronger morale and fewer interpersonal conflicts.


  • Safer and More Reliable Work Performance. Fatigue-related cognitive impairment from untreated sleep apnea has been shown to mimic a blood alcohol level of 0.08%—the legal limit to drive.


  • Treated employees have a 70% lower risk of fatigue-related workplace accidents, particularly in safety-sensitive jobs.

UNDERDIAGNOSED—AND UNDERESTIMATED

1 in 5 Canadian adults is estimated to have obstructive sleep apnea (OSA). 


Up to 80% remain undiagnosed, often because symptoms—like snoring, fatigue, or morning headaches—are normalized or overlooked


Fatigue-related accidents cost the Canadian economy an estimated $2.3 billion annually in lost productivity and preventable workplace incidents. 


Employees with untreated sleep apnea are more likely to make mistakes, get injured, or experience burnout 


$2.3 billion per year is lost to fatigue-related productivity declines and workplace incidents across Canada  


Workers with untreated sleep apnea are twice as likely to take disability leave and three times more likely to report reduced work effectiveness 


Fatigue-related impairment in cognitive tasks has been shown to mimic a blood alcohol level of 0.08%—the legal limit to drive.


Drowsy driving causes an estimated 20% of all serious car accidents in Canada.
